Mod Post Mod Update: Reports Regarding a Moderator
Hey everyone,
We want to address the concerns that were recently raised regarding one of our moderators. We acknowledge the grievance, looked into it, and after reviewing the information and conducting a background check, we have decided to remove her from the mod team and ban her account.
We also want to be transparent about how this happened. She had only been a moderator for around a month, and even during that time, she only had permissions to remove posts/comments — she did not have permissions to ban users or take other major moderation actions.
At the time we recruited her, we were also very short on moderators. Because of that, we didn't carry out the background check as thoroughly as we normally should have, and this slipped past the attention of both me and the other senior moderators. That's something we take responsibility for, and we'll be more careful about recruitment going forward.
We genuinely try our best to keep the subreddit clean. We remove political, religious, NSFW and other rule-breaking content whenever we come across it, but the reality is that there are times when things slip through. We've been running with only around 4–5 consistently active moderators, so we can't catch absolutely everything immediately.
That's also why Modmail is there. If you see something that breaks the rules, please report it to us. It makes it much easier for us to notice something we've missed and take action quickly.
We do appreciate the person who brought this to our attention and helped us find the issue. We just wish the concern had been sent to us through Modmail first instead of being posted publicly, because we could have looked into it and dealt with it directly.
Either way, we've now reviewed the situation, taken action, and the account has been removed from the mod team and banned from the subreddit.
Thanks to everyone who reports things in good faith and helps us keep the community clean. We know we aren't perfect, but we're doing our best with the team we have, and we'll continue working to improve.
